I am showing how I do composting in my garden. I just don't like to throw all that goodness into garbage or brown bags. Our kitchen scraps and garden clippings can be turned successfully into wonderful soil amendments. Patience, time and a little bit of work will reward us with plenty of good soil amendments, rich in nutrients and super good for our plants.

Hello Olga. As you are filling the bags and when they are full and hidden away, do you leave the bags open for rain to go in? Also, how big are the holes you are making in your bags? Thank you so much. I am storing my weeds etc in a big bucket in my garage until I get this set up ❤️
@OlgaCarmody
@OlgaCarmody 2 года назад
Yes, I do leave the bags open. The holes don’t have to be of any size, water will escape even through smallest openings. I just poke an inch size cuts…

Thank you Olga! Does it matter if garden waste has any damage such as different fungus on leaves from heavy rains etc ?
@OlgaCarmody
@OlgaCarmody 2 года назад
I don’t think it matters as long as you let your compost get fully aged. Same with seeds. Some people worry that those will sprout. No, if you let everything get really aged. Beware of horse manure though, whatever those animals eat, that’s what you will get.
